Ukrainian Armed Forces Hit Explosives Plant in Russia and Feodosia Oil Terminal

On Monday night, the Ukrainian Defense Forces struck strategic military and industrial facilities in Russia and occupied Crimea.

According to the General Staff of the Armed Forces of Ukraine, one of the targets was an explosives and ammunition plant in the Nizhny Novgorod region of the Russian Federation.

An oil terminal in Feodosia, located in the temporarily occupied Crimea, was also hit.

“As part of the reduction of the enemy’s offensive potential and ability to carry out missile and bomb strikes, on the night of October 6, units of the Ukrainian Defense Forces hit the infrastructure of the federal state enterprise Sverdlov Plant,” the General Staff said.

The company is one of Russia’s largest explosives manufacturers.

The Sverdlov plant. Photo from open sources

The plant is capable of producing almost all types of ammunition: aircraft and artillery shells, aircraft bombs, including corrected bombs, warheads of cumulative anti-tank guided missiles, ammunition for engineer troops, and warheads of air defense missile systems.

As part of industrial cooperation, the enterprise assembles unified glide bombs used across different branches of the Russian armed forces.

In addition, in the occupied Crimea, the facilities of the Sea Oil Terminal JSC in Feodosia were damaged.

This is a multifunctional technological complex that provides transshipment of oil and oil products between railroad tank cars, ships and road transport.

The facility is actively used for logistics support of the Russian occupation army groups.

As a result of the hit, a large-scale fire broke out on the territory of the terminal.

Separately, the ammunition depot of a separate logistics battalion of the 18th Combined Arms Army of the Russian Federation in Crimea was hit. The results of the strike are being clarified.
